English Roots: Rye Clearing
One of the main paths for the name Riley, so it seems, leads us back to Old English. Here, it's derived from specific place names. Imagine, if you will, a time long ago, when settlements were often named after features of the land around them. Riley, in this context, comes from two Old English words: 'ryge,' which means 'rye,' and 'lēah,' which translates to 'wood' or 'clearing.' So, when you hear the name Riley with its English roots, you're really hearing a description of a peaceful, open space, a clearing in a wood where rye might have been grown. Irish Heritage: Valiant and Courageous
Then, there's another, very distinct, path for the name Riley, one that takes us across the Irish Sea. This version of the name comes from the Irish surname O'Reilly. This is a name that, quite honestly, has a very different feel to it compared to the English 'rye clearing.' The Irish origin points to a much more personal characteristic. The root of O'Reilly, 'Raghallaigh,' means 'valiant' or 'courageous.' So, in a way, the Irish Riley carries with it a sense of bravery, a strong spirit, and a willingness to face challenges. Awards and Recognition in the Industry
Riley Reid's career, you know, is truly marked by a significant number of accolades. She has, quite remarkably, won over 45 awards, which is a testament to her consistent performance and popularity within the adult film industry. These awards are, basically, a clear indication of her talent and the respect she has garnered from her peers and fans alike. For instance, she received the 2014 XBIZ Award for Female Performer of the Year. That's a pretty big one, actually. Then, just a couple of years later, in 2016, she also won the AVN Award for Female Performer of the Year. These aren't just minor awards; they're some of the most prestigious honors in her industry, highlighting her consistent excellence and impact.
